About Casino
AI Casino tools are a specialized category of software that uses artificial intelligence to analyze, simulate, and optimize casino games. These tools leverage machine learning algorithms and predictive analytics to model player behavior, calculate probabilities, and manage risk. Their primary value lies in helping game developers balance game mechanics and enabling casino operators to enhance security and operational efficiency. They provide deep insights into game performance and player patterns that are not achievable through manual analysis.
Core Features
- Predictive Modeling: Forecasts player behavior, lifetime value, and potential churn based on historical data.
- Game Simulation & Balancing: Runs millions of game rounds to test and adjust return-to-player (RTP), volatility, and feature frequency.
- Risk Management: Identifies high-risk betting patterns and potential bonus abuse to minimize financial losses.
- AI Opponent Generation: Creates sophisticated and realistic AI players for skill-based games like poker and blackjack.
- Fraud Detection: Analyzes real-time gameplay data to detect collusion, bot usage, or other forms of cheating.
Use Cases
These tools are primarily used by online casino operators, game development studios, and data analysts in the iGaming industry. For instance, a developer might use a simulation tool to ensure a new slot game is both engaging and profitable before launch. An operator could deploy a fraud detection system to monitor live poker tables for unfair play.

AI-Powered Balancing for Slot Machine Design
A game designer at a development studio is tasked with creating a new online slot machine. They use an AI simulation tool to run millions of virtual spins on their proposed game mechanics. The AI analyzes the results to calculate the precise Return-to-Player (RTP) percentage and volatility index. Based on the analysis, the designer adjusts symbol payout values and bonus feature triggers to ensure the game is both exciting for players and meets the casino's profitability targets, significantly reducing manual calculation time and guesswork.
Developing Advanced AI Poker Opponents
A developer for an online poker platform needs to create challenging and human-like AI opponents. They use an AI generation tool that has been trained on millions of real-world hand histories. The developer can set parameters to create bots with distinct playing styles, such as 'Tight-Aggressive' or 'Loose-Passive'. This allows the platform to offer a more engaging single-player experience and provide realistic practice partners for players looking to improve their skills against varied strategies.
Real-Time Fraud Detection in Online Blackjack
An online casino operator integrates an AI-powered monitoring tool into their live blackjack tables. The system analyzes betting patterns and decisions across all players in real-time. It automatically flags suspicious activities, such as highly correlated betting between multiple accounts (suggesting collusion) or betting patterns that perfectly match card-counting strategies. The security team receives an alert, allowing them to investigate and take action swiftly, protecting the integrity of the game and preventing financial losses.
Predicting Player Churn for Retention Marketing
A marketing team at an online casino uses a predictive analytics tool to identify players at risk of churning (stopping play). The AI model analyzes player data, including session length, betting frequency, deposit amounts, and game choices. It assigns a 'churn risk score' to each player. The marketing team then targets players with high scores with personalized retention offers, such as free spins or deposit bonuses, proactively reducing player attrition and increasing overall customer lifetime value.

Personalized Strategy Analysis for Poker Players
A professional poker player aims to improve their game by identifying strategic weaknesses. They upload their entire hand history from an online platform to an AI analysis tool. The software processes the data and compares the player's decisions against Game Theory Optimal (GTO) play in thousands of different scenarios. It generates a report highlighting 'leaks' in their strategy, such as calling too often on the river or not three-betting enough from the button. This provides actionable insights for study and improvement, acting as a virtual coach.
